The Horsefly Musical Theatre Group is taking a romp through the 1970s with its Horsefly Follies show Follywood in the 70s.

The skits are loose interpretations of TV sitcoms and shows of the 1970s and promise lots of giggles.

The Horsefly Follies troupe kicks off its two-week run this Friday evening with a special performance for children and youth 18 and under.

The entry fee at the door is just $2 for ages 18 and under and $6 for adults. 

There will be a concession during this special showing starging at 7 p.m.

Co-director Christina Mary says there are still lots of tickets for this Friday’s show and the adult show Saturday, April 30, but tickets are selling fast for the May 6 adult show and almost sold out for the final May 7 adult show. 

Start times for the adult shows are 7:30 p.m. with doors opening at 6:30 p.m. 

There will also be nightly door prizes and auctions.

The regular shows include a bar and are for adults only with tickets at $12.50 each available in advance at Clarkes Store.

Proceeds from the shows go to the Horsefly Community Club for various ongoing programs such as the swim program, Volunteer Fire Department, Old Fashioned Christmas, Halloween party, and other worthy community projects.
